  • the bright screen control method of the embodiment controls the frequency and brightness of the bright screen by detecting whether the user currently views a new message or an incoming call after receiving an incoming call or a new message, and does not light up or lighten the screen with a low brightness value when not necessary. Thereby reducing the power consumption of the display while achieving the reminder effect.
  • the screen can be illuminated in time, thereby reducing the power consumption of the display while improving the user experience.
  • the screen is not illuminated, and other reminding methods (such as flashing, vibrating, ringing) Etc.) Still executing, so that when the terminal is placed in a bag, in a pocket, or down on a table or covered by other objects, the screen may not be illuminated, and the call or new message reminder effect is achieved. Reduced display power consumption.
  • whether the terminal is in a stationary state is determined according to data collected by the acceleration sensor, and if the terminal is not in a stationary state, the screen is not illuminated, and the reminder is performed by other means (such as flashing, vibrating, ringing, etc.).
  • the screen When the terminal is in a motion state (for example, when the user walks), the screen may not be illuminated, thereby reducing the power consumption of the display while achieving the effect of the incoming call or the new message reminder.
  • the display may be illuminated at a first brightness value lower than the normal brightness according to data collected by the current light sensor or may not be illuminated.
  • the acceleration sensor is used to monitor whether the static state of the terminal is changed in real time. If the terminal is detected to change from the stationary state to the motion state, the display brightness is gradually increased to a normal level or the display screen is directly illuminated. Normal brightness. In this way, the display can be illuminated to normal brightness when the terminal is touched or picked up, so that the user can view new messages or incoming calls.
  • the bright screen control method may further include: when the reminder ends, determining that the terminal is still in a stationary state according to data collected by the acceleration sensor, starting a timer to perform timing; Before the duration, it is determined whether the stationary state of the terminal is changed according to the data collected by the acceleration sensor, and the static state of the terminal changes to illuminate the terminal display screen to the second brightness value corresponding to the normal level. That is to say, in this embodiment, the timer is turned on in the case of missed call or unread information, and the static state of the terminal is monitored in real time before the predetermined time period, and if the terminal is monitored to change from the stationary state to the motion, Then gradually increase the brightness of the display to a normal level. In this way, when the terminal is detected to be touched or picked up within a certain length of time, the display screen is illuminated to normal brightness, so that the user can view new messages or incoming calls.
  • the bright screen control method may further include: detecting whether the terminal is currently in a bright screen state; thus, the sensor may be activated when the terminal is currently in the interest screen state. In an exemplary embodiment, if it is detected that the terminal is currently in a bright screen state, it is likely to indicate that the user is currently viewing the display screen, and at this time, the reminder can be performed by popping up the window, and all other than the pop-up window is removed. Reminders to alert in the most efficient way while reducing power consumption due to multiple ways of simultaneously alerting.
  • FIG. 2 is a flow chart of the bright screen control process in this embodiment. The main steps are as follows:
  • Step 201 The terminal receives a call, a short message or other notification message.
  • Step 202 After receiving the above information, the terminal first determines whether the current state is in a bright state.
  • Step 203 If the terminal is already in a bright state, the user should be watching the display screen, and only need to prompt the box to remind the caller or have a new message to achieve the effect of the reminder, so in addition to the bullet box, cancel other forms of reminder (such as Vibration, ringing, flashing lights, etc.).
  • Step 204 If the terminal is in the state of the interest screen, the acceleration sensor, the proximity sensor, and the light sensor are turned on, and the acceleration sensor, the proximity sensor, and the light sensor collect data in real time.
  • Step 205 Determine, according to the data collected by the acceleration sensor, whether the current terminal is in a static state.
  • Step 206 If the terminal is in a motion state, it is possible that the terminal is placed in the bag and the hand, and the user is in a motion state, or the display terminal is reversed on the table, and at this time, only the ringtone and the vibration reminder are needed. Calls or new messages can be used to remind the user of the effect, no need to brighten the screen, so in this case, no bright screen, the reminder mode does not change, close the open sensor.
  • Step 207 If the terminal is in a static state, determine whether there is an object occlusion in front of the current display screen of the terminal according to the data collected by the proximity sensor. If there is occlusion, return to step 206, and if there is no occlusion, proceed to step 208.
  • Step 208 If it is determined that the display screen of the terminal is not blocked, the proximity sensor is turned off, and the display screen is adjusted to be lower than the light sensing data collected by the light sensor before the user picks up the terminal to observe, without requiring high brightness.
  • the first value of the normal level or it may not be bright.
  • Step 209 Before the end of the reminding action, judge whether the static state of the terminal is changed according to the data collected by the acceleration sensor. Actually, it is used to determine whether the user has touched or picked up the terminal.
  • Step 210 If the terminal is detected to change from the stationary state to the motion state, it can be regarded as the user touches or picks up the terminal, then terminates all forms (such as ringing, vibration, etc.) and gradually increases the brightness of the display to a normal level. In order to allow users to view incoming calls or new messages.
  • Step 211 Turn off the acceleration sensor and the light sensor.
  • Step 212 When the action of the reminder ends, the terminal is still in a static state, that is, if there is a missed call or no information, the timer is turned on.
  • Step 213 Before the timing reaches the predetermined time length T, continue to determine whether the static state of the terminal changes according to the data collected by the acceleration sensor, and if there is a change, return to step 210 to improve the user experience.
  • the predetermined duration T can be set to a default value or set by the user, and the predetermined duration T should not be too long to prevent the user from having to take away instead of viewing the terminal without having to brighten the screen.

Abstract

L'invention concerne un procédé et un dispositif de commande d'écran allumé, et un terminal. Le procédé consiste à : démarrer des capteurs lorsqu'il existe un appel entrant ou un nouveau message, les capteurs comprenant un capteur d'accélération et un capteur de proximité ; déterminer si un terminal est actuellement dans un état stationnaire selon les données acquises par le capteur d'accélération, et/ou déterminer s'il existe actuellement un objet bloquant devant l'écran d'affichage du terminal selon les données acquises par le capteur de proximité ; et conserver un état d'écran éteint et donner une invite à l'aide de modes autres que l'écran allumé lorsqu'il est déterminé qu'il existe actuellement un objet bloquant devant l'écran d'affichage du terminal et/ou il est déterminé que le terminal est actuellement dans un état de déplacement.
